I am on a roll, last night I decided at 8:30 that instead of watching the Voice, I would make a rag baby blanket.

I bought the fabric to make a blanket for Dh's cousin's baby. The baby is 8 now. I had cut most the strips, and doubled some with batting. I have no idea where the rest of the batting went.

It took me until 1:00 am to get the fabric cut ( I ripped the long strips), then cut into 5" squares, doubled (no batting), sewn, then the dreaded snipping. I am so glad I invested in spring loaded snippers.

It is going through the second wash cycle right now. I will get dh to take photos tonight, before I take it to the shower.
